Opis:
This research aims to determine the composition of the best filter media on tilapia (Oreochromis niloticus) production performance. The method used in this research is experimental methods use Completely Randomized Design (CRD), which consist of four variables and three replications. The variable used is (A) without media filter (Control); (B) combination of cotton, bio ball and charcoal; (C) combination of cotton bioring and charcoal; (D) combination of cotton, Japanese matt and charcoal. The test fish used 180 tilapia fish with 7-9 cm length size. Tanks that used measured 60 cm x 30 cm x 36 cm as many as 12 pieces. The density during the research was 15 tails per tank. Duration of maintenance is 40 days. The feeding level is given by 5% of fish body weight. Water quality parameters (temperature, dissolved oxygen, pH, ammonia, and nitrate) were observed every 10 days for 40 days. Other parameters are survival rate, absolute length and weight growth, specific growth rate and feed convertion ratio observed every 7 days for 40 days. The results showed that the best composition of filter media for tilapia production performance was combination of cotton, bioball, and charcoal. Tilapia production performance obtained a combination of cotton filter media, bioball, and charcoal with 100% survival rate, length growth 2.17 cm, weight growth of 9.91 g, and specific growth rate of 2.3% and feed conversion ratio of 1.88.

Opis:
The research was carried out at the Laboratory of Aquaculture, Faculty of Fisheries and Marine Sciences, Universitas Padjadjaran for culture and observation of fish and at the Poultry Nutrition Laboratory, Faculty of Animal Husbandry, Padjadjaran University on the fermentation process and the manufacture of test feeding. The purpose of this study was to determine the optimal percentage of Aspergillus niger fermented mangrove propagules meal in artificial feeding on the growth rate of nile tilapia. Tilapia fry used were 5-7 cm in size with an average weight of 4.97 ± 0.2 g. The study used a Completely Random Design (CRD) with five treatments and three repetition. Feeding is formulated on the percentage of fermented mangrove propagules meal use, that is 0; 2,5; 5; 7.5; and 10%. The main parameters observed were nutritional quality of fermented products, daily growth rate, feeding efficiency and survival. The data obtained were analyzed using F Test and continued with Duncan's Test if there were differences between treatments. The results showed that the addition of mangrove propagules fermented about 10% level. It gives results that there is no difference between the daily growth rate, feeding efficiency and survival whic is the same as those in tilapia. This is shows that mangrove propagulees can be used in fish feeding without causing negative effects on the growth of nile tilapia fry.
